Introduction to Native Plants NZ
Native plants in New Zealand are those that naturally occur in the country and have evolved to thrive in its specific climate and conditions. These plants have adapted to the local soil, climate, and wildlife, making them well-suited to the New Zealand environment. Using native plants in your landscaping can help create a sense of place and connection to the natural surroundings.
Benefits of Using Native Plants NZ
1. Biodiversity Support
Native plants play a crucial role in supporting local ecosystems and biodiversity. They provide food and habitat for native insects, birds, and other wildlife, helping to create a balanced and healthy ecosystem. By incorporating native plants nz into your garden, you can help support the local wildlife population and promote biodiversity in your area.
2. Low Maintenance
Native plants are well adapted to the local climate and soil conditions, making them relatively low maintenance compared to non-native plants. Once established, native plants require minimal watering, fertilizing, and pest control, reducing the need for chemical inputs and saving you time and effort in the long run.
3. Water Conservation
Many native plants in New Zealand are drought-tolerant and can thrive in low-water environments. By using native plants in your landscaping, you can reduce water consumption and create a more sustainable garden that is resilient to changing weather patterns. Native plants also help prevent soil erosion and improve water quality by filtering rainwater runoff.
How to Incorporate Native Plants NZ into Your Landscape Design
When planning your eco-friendly landscape design with native plants from New Zealand, consider the following tips:
Research native plant species that are well-suited to your specific location and soil conditions.
Create a planting plan that incorporates a mix of native trees, shrubs, and ground covers to provide a diverse habitat for wildlife.
Group plants according to their water and sunlight needs to create efficient watering zones and reduce water consumption.
Consider the mature size of the plants and their growth habits to avoid overcrowding and maintenance issues in the future.
